Transaction 148f5f68fad0cd7ad2f9082e256a3af2885090aabb3c9e0c8bfdfc01651da758
1 Input
1 Output
-
148f5f68fad0cd7ad2f9082e256a3af2885090aabb3c9e0c8bfdfc01651da758:0
- value
- 1127698692
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b46706354c1befc3e07b089e79d6b8569b4737e OP_EQUALVERIFY OP_CHECKSIG
- address
- 13VDdNM4Hc67X4X4psH34VjDGB42ewZzAh